So i figure what the hell might as well post this up, this was at Midwest SPL Finals (so its legit, best ive done is a 150.5 with these, just not at an event, and it was much colder of a day when i did that compared to this). this metering style is on the glass (like db drag) but with windows and doors able to be open during the run. and yes, i lost to an AQ HDC3, but thats not the point of this LOL system is in a 1997 chevy cavalier, box is around 5 cubes with a 6" aero, burps at 42 hz, enjoy the vid (best if watched in hd)- Let's see some videos!

way too big for the power, 5 cubes tuned to 29 hz with one 6inch aero- SPL: more Port Area or lower Port Mach?????
test, with spl every little thing will change somthing, whether its your impediance rise or your score alone. every little thing changes somthing. for my car, small port was better, now for yours, huge port might be better (and by small port i mean 5 sq per cube!) So there will never be a straight awnser for this, its somthing you need to find on your own, with testing.- 2 sa-12s daily on a [email protected]
